HTML color code #64DC62

Color name: None
RGB: 100, 220, 98
HSL: 119.02deg, 63.54%, 62.35%
Web safe color: No

RGB complementary color:

A complementary color for this color is #D963DB.

HTML examples

<p style="color:#64DC62;">Your text using HTML color code.</p>
<p style="color:rgb(100 220 98);">Your text using RGB color values.</p>
<p style="color:hsl(119.02deg 63.54% 62.35%);">Your text using HSL color values.</p>

CSS code examples

<style> p { color:#64DC62; } </style>
<style> p { color:rgb(100 220 98); } </style>
<style> p { color:hsl(119.02deg 63.54% 62.35%); } </style>
